How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 55410?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| 55410 Studio Apartments | $1,495 | $1,200 | $1,702 |
| 55410 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,395 | $1,100 | $5,670 |
| 55410 2 Bedroom Apartments | $4,076 | $1,395 | $7,655 |
| 55410 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,803 | $1,895 | $4,976 |
| 55410 4 Bedroom Apartments | $10,193 | $9,950 | $10,679 |
